Senior Applied & Agentic AI Engineer Job Responsibilities

  • Lead the architecture and delivery of enterprise‑grade LLM and agentic AI systems that transform claims, risk, and operational workflows.
  • Define technical strategy for retrieval‑augmented generation (RAG), multi‑agent orchestration, and autonomous workflow automation.
  • Design and implement advanced agentic systems capable of planning, reasoning, tool selection, execution, reflection, and recovery.
  • Architect stateful, memory‑aware AI systems that manage long‑running claims processes across multiple touchpoints.
  • Build multi‑agent collaboration models that coordinate coverage analysis, document validation, fraud signals, compliance checks, and decision support.
  • Establish orchestration frameworks that manage task routing, context persistence, structured outputs, and failure handling.
  • Design secure tool integration layers connecting agents to claims systems, policy platforms, data warehouses, document repositories, and external data services.
  • Implement deterministic guardrails, schema validation, and output verification pipelines to reduce hallucination and execution risk.
  • Lead development of document intelligence systems leveraging LLMs for summarization, entity extraction, discrepancy detection, and structured data reconstruction.
  • Define prompt engineering standards and reusable reasoning templates for consistent, domain‑aware outputs.
  • Oversee embedding strategies, vector indexing architecture, retrieval optimization, and knowledge grounding approaches.
  • Design evaluation frameworks to measure reasoning depth, workflow completion accuracy, hallucination rates, latency, and cost efficiency.
  • Implement observability layers that track agent decisions, tool usage, retrieval effectiveness, and drift across models and prompts.
  • Drive optimization strategies for token efficiency, caching, batching, and inference scaling.
  • Ensure compliance with Responsible AI principles, enterprise governance standards, audit requirements, and regulatory constraints.
  • Partner with enterprise architecture, cybersecurity, and data governance teams to define secure deployment patterns.
  • Mentor engineers on LLM orchestration patterns, workflow decomposition, and safe agent design.
  • Translate executive‑level business objectives into scalable AI platform capabilities.
  • Lead proof‑of‑concepts through full production deployment with measurable ROI outcomes.
  • Continuously evaluate emerging foundation models, orchestration frameworks, and agent tooling for enterprise readiness.
Qualifications
  • Bachelor's or Master's degree in Computer Science, Artificial Intelligence, Engineering, or related discipline.
  • 7-10+ years of experience in AI engineering, machine learning systems, or distributed software architecture.
  • 3-5+ years designing and deploying LLM‑powered systems in production environments.
  • Demonstrated experience architecting full agentic AI systems with planning, reflection, memory, and tool execution components.
  • Deep expertise in RAG architectures, embedding strategies, vector databases, and retrieval optimization.
  • Strong experience designing multi‑agent orchestration frameworks and workflow engines.
  • Advanced proficiency in Python and enterprise API integration patterns.
  • Experience building secure, scalable microservices in cloud‑native environments.
  • Strong understanding of distributed systems, event‑driven architectures, and system reliability principles.
  • Experience implementing structured output enforcement, guardrails, and audit logging mechanisms.
  • Demonstrated ability to design evaluation and benchmarking frameworks for LLM and agent reliability.
  • Experience operating in regulated industries such as insurance, financial services, or healthcare preferred.
  • Proven leadership in technical design reviews, architecture governance, and cross‑functional collaboration.
  • Strong ability to balance innovation with enterprise risk management and operational stability.
